AUTO BEAT LOOP control

! Turn:

Set the length of the auto beat loop’s loop in units of beats.

! Press:

Turns loop playback on and off.

2

JOG DRUM button

Use this to turn the jog drum function on and off.
= Using the jog drum function (p.25)

3

SAMPLE LAUNCH button

Use this to load this unit’s internal sampled sound sources.
= Using the sample launch function (p.25)

4

Jog dial

! Scratch

When the jog dial is set to the [VINYL] mode and the jog dial is
turned while pressing down on its top, the sound is played in the
direction and at the speed at which the jog dial is turned.

! Pitch bend

The playing speed can be adjusted by turning the outer part of
the jog dial during playback.

5

TEMPO RANGE button

The [TEMPO] slider’s range of variation switches each time this is
pressed.

6

MASTER TEMPO button

Use this to turn the master tempo function on and off.

7

TEMPO slider

Use this to adjust the track playing speed.

8

SYNC button

Synchronizes to the master deck’s tempo.
= Using the SYNC function (p.26)

9

MASTER indicator

This lights when the SYNC function is set to “MASTER”.

a f

(PLAY/PAUSE) button

Use this to play/pause tracks.

b

CUE button

! Press:

Sets a cue point or moves the cue point.

! [SHIFT] + press:

The playing position moves to the beginning of the track.

c

SHIFT button

When another button is pressed while pressing the [SHIFT] button, a
different function is called out.

Playback

Press the [f (PLAY/PAUSE)] button.

 Pausing

During playback, press the [f (PLAY/PAUSE)] button.

! Playback resumes when [f (PLAY/PAUSE)] button is pressed

again.

! When the jog dial is turned while pausing, the position can be moved

in units of 10 msec.

Forward and reverse scanning

Turn the jog dial while pressing the [SHIFT] button.

The track is fast-forwarded/fast-reversed in the direction in which the jog
dial is spun.
! When the [SHIFT] button is released, this function is canceled.
! When you stop the jog dial from spinning, normal playback resumes.
! The fast-forward/fast-reverse speed can be adjusted according to the

speed at which the jog dial is spun.

Adjusting the playing speed (Tempo

control)

Move the [TEMPO] slider forward or backward.

The playing speed increases when the slider is moved to the [+] side
(towards you), decreases when the slider is moved to the [] side (away
from you).
The rate at which the playing speed is changed is indicated on the main
unit display.

 Selecting the playing speed adjustment range

Press the [TEMPO RANGE] button.

The playing speed adjustment range switches each time the button is
pressed.
[WIDE, ±16, ±10, ±6] lights on the main unit display.

 Adjusting the playing speed without changing

the pitch (Master Tempo)

Press the [MASTER TEMPO] button.

The [MASTER TEMPO] indicator lights. The pitch does not change even
when the playing speed is changed with the [TEMPO] slider.
! The sound is digitally processed, so the sound quality changes.

Setting Cue

1 During playback, press the [f (PLAY/PAUSE)]
button.

Playback is paused.

2 Press the [CUE ] button.

The point at which the track is paused is set as the cue point.
The [f (PLAY/PAUSE)] indicator flashes and the [CUE ] indicator
lights. No sound is output at this time.
